Abstract
We construct solutions of the Liouville equationΔu+ϵ2eu=0in Ω with Ω a smooth bounded domain in R2R2, with Robin boundary condition∂u∂ν+λu=0on ∂Ω. The solutions constructed exhibit concentration as ϵ→0ϵ→0 and simultaneously as λ→+∞λ→+∞, at points that get close to the boundary, and shows that in general the set of solutions of this problems exhibits a richer structure than the problem with Dirichlet boundary conditions.
